GITNUXBEST LIST

Personal Care Services

Top 10 Best Cleaning Services Software of 2026

Discover top cleaning services software to streamline your business. Compare features, find the best fit for your needs today.

Jannik Lindner

Jannik Lindner

Feb 11, 2026

10 tools comparedExpert reviewed
Independent evaluation · Unbiased commentary · Updated regularly
Learn more
In the competitive world of cleaning services, efficient operations are critical to profitability and client trust—specialized software bridges gaps in scheduling, invoicing, and team management. With a range of tools available, selecting the right system can elevate business performance; discover the top 10 options tailored to meet diverse operational needs, from small firms to enterprise-level teams.

Quick Overview

  1. 1#1: ZenMaid - Comprehensive software tailored for house cleaning businesses, handling scheduling, invoicing, client communication, and team management.
  2. 2#2: Jobber - All-in-one field service management platform for cleaning services with quoting, scheduling, invoicing, and GPS tracking.
  3. 3#3: Housecall Pro - Mobile-first software for cleaning pros offering booking, dispatching, payments, and customer retention tools.
  4. 4#4: CleanGuru - Cloud-based app for cleaning companies focused on job scheduling, employee tracking, invoicing, and QuickBooks integration.
  5. 5#5: Swept - Operations platform for cleaning businesses automating scheduling, billing, and franchise management.
  6. 6#6: BookingKoala - Online booking and scheduling software designed for cleaning services with automated reminders and payments.
  7. 7#7: ServiceTitan - Enterprise-grade platform for cleaning and home services with advanced CRM, dispatching, and financial tools.
  8. 8#8: Kickserv - Field service software for cleaning operations including job management, time tracking, and reporting.
  9. 9#9: FieldPulse - Mobile CRM and scheduling tool for cleaning services supporting jobs, estimates, and invoicing on the go.
  10. 10#10: Workiz - Cloud-based management system for service businesses like cleaning with scheduling, invoicing, and call tracking.

We evaluated tools based on feature depth (including scheduling, CRM, and payment processing), usability (intuitive design and mobile functionality), reliability, and overall value, ensuring they deliver robust solutions for varying business scales and operational demands.

Comparison Table

Cleaning services software simplifies day-to-day operations, and with tools like ZenMaid, Jobber, Housecall Pro, and CleanGuru, finding the right fit is critical. This comparison table outlines key features, pricing structures, and usability to help readers identify the software that aligns with their business needs, covering scheduling, invoicing, and client management.

1ZenMaid logo9.8/10

Comprehensive software tailored for house cleaning businesses, handling scheduling, invoicing, client communication, and team management.

Features
9.7/10
Ease
9.5/10
Value
9.6/10
2Jobber logo9.1/10

All-in-one field service management platform for cleaning services with quoting, scheduling, invoicing, and GPS tracking.

Features
9.4/10
Ease
8.7/10
Value
8.9/10

Mobile-first software for cleaning pros offering booking, dispatching, payments, and customer retention tools.

Features
9.1/10
Ease
8.4/10
Value
8.2/10
4CleanGuru logo8.2/10

Cloud-based app for cleaning companies focused on job scheduling, employee tracking, invoicing, and QuickBooks integration.

Features
8.4/10
Ease
8.6/10
Value
7.9/10
5Swept logo8.4/10

Operations platform for cleaning businesses automating scheduling, billing, and franchise management.

Features
8.6/10
Ease
9.1/10
Value
8.0/10

Online booking and scheduling software designed for cleaning services with automated reminders and payments.

Features
8.2/10
Ease
8.7/10
Value
9.0/10

Enterprise-grade platform for cleaning and home services with advanced CRM, dispatching, and financial tools.

Features
8.2/10
Ease
7.0/10
Value
6.5/10
8Kickserv logo8.1/10

Field service software for cleaning operations including job management, time tracking, and reporting.

Features
8.3/10
Ease
8.5/10
Value
7.8/10
9FieldPulse logo8.1/10

Mobile CRM and scheduling tool for cleaning services supporting jobs, estimates, and invoicing on the go.

Features
8.3/10
Ease
8.7/10
Value
7.5/10
10Workiz logo7.9/10

Cloud-based management system for service businesses like cleaning with scheduling, invoicing, and call tracking.

Features
8.2/10
Ease
7.6/10
Value
7.4/10
1
ZenMaid logo

ZenMaid

specialized

Comprehensive software tailored for house cleaning businesses, handling scheduling, invoicing, client communication, and team management.

Overall Rating9.8/10
Features
9.7/10
Ease of Use
9.5/10
Value
9.6/10
Standout Feature

Drag-and-drop scheduling board with color-coded recurring jobs and real-time crew availability

ZenMaid is a comprehensive software platform tailored for cleaning service businesses, offering tools for scheduling, dispatching, invoicing, and client management. It features a drag-and-drop scheduler, automated reminders, online booking, and two-way texting to streamline daily operations. With integrations like QuickBooks and robust reporting, it enables cleaning companies to scale efficiently while reducing administrative burdens.

Pros

  • Intuitive drag-and-drop scheduling tailored for cleaning crews
  • Powerful automation for invoicing, reminders, and payments
  • Exceptional customer support with quick response times

Cons

  • Higher pricing tiers may be steep for solo cleaners
  • Advanced reporting requires some setup time
  • Limited third-party integrations compared to general CRM tools

Best For

Growing cleaning service businesses with multiple teams seeking end-to-end automation and scalability.

Pricing

Starts at $49/month (Starter, 1-5 maids), $99/month (Pro, up to 20 maids), $199/month (Premium, unlimited); 14-day free trial available.

Visit ZenMaidzenmaid.com
2
Jobber logo

Jobber

specialized

All-in-one field service management platform for cleaning services with quoting, scheduling, invoicing, and GPS tracking.

Overall Rating9.1/10
Features
9.4/10
Ease of Use
8.7/10
Value
8.9/10
Standout Feature

Client Hub – self-service portal where clients can request cleanings, approve quotes, pay invoices, and view service history independently.

Jobber is a robust field service management platform tailored for small to medium-sized service businesses, including cleaning services, offering tools for scheduling, quoting, invoicing, and client management. It enables efficient dispatching of cleaning teams, tracking of job progress via mobile app, and automation of recurring cleanings. The software also includes CRM features, payment processing, and reporting to help streamline operations and improve customer satisfaction.

Pros

  • Comprehensive scheduling and dispatching for teams and recurring cleaning jobs
  • Integrated invoicing, payments, and client portal for seamless transactions
  • Strong mobile app for on-the-go job management and GPS tracking

Cons

  • Pricing scales quickly with team size and advanced features
  • Steeper learning curve for custom reports and integrations
  • Limited customization options for highly specialized cleaning workflows

Best For

Growing cleaning service businesses with 2-20 employees needing an all-in-one platform for operations, billing, and customer management.

Pricing

Lite ($49/mo), Core ($119/mo), Connect ($239/mo), Grow ($349+/mo); billed annually with additional costs for extra users and features.

Visit Jobbergetjobber.com
3
Housecall Pro logo

Housecall Pro

specialized

Mobile-first software for cleaning pros offering booking, dispatching, payments, and customer retention tools.

Overall Rating8.7/10
Features
9.1/10
Ease of Use
8.4/10
Value
8.2/10
Standout Feature

Automated recurring job scheduling with customer reminders and online booking, ideal for ongoing cleaning contracts

Housecall Pro is a comprehensive field service management software tailored for home service businesses, including cleaning services, offering tools for scheduling, dispatching, invoicing, and payments. It features a robust mobile app for technicians, online booking portals for customers, and automation for recurring cleanings like weekly or monthly jobs. The platform integrates with QuickBooks and provides GPS tracking, helping cleaning companies streamline operations and improve efficiency.

Pros

  • Powerful scheduling and dispatching with drag-and-drop calendar and real-time GPS tracking
  • Integrated invoicing, payments, and QuickBooks sync for quick job completion
  • Strong mobile app and customer self-booking portal to reduce admin time

Cons

  • Higher pricing tiers needed for advanced features like unlimited users
  • Limited built-in inventory or supply management specific to cleaning products
  • Steeper learning curve for non-tech-savvy users despite intuitive interface

Best For

Mid-sized cleaning service providers with field technicians seeking an all-in-one platform for scheduling, billing, and customer management.

Pricing

Starts at $65/user/month (Basic, billed annually) up to $229+/user/month (Max), with add-ons for marketing and premium support.

Visit Housecall Prohousecallpro.com
4
CleanGuru logo

CleanGuru

specialized

Cloud-based app for cleaning companies focused on job scheduling, employee tracking, invoicing, and QuickBooks integration.

Overall Rating8.2/10
Features
8.4/10
Ease of Use
8.6/10
Value
7.9/10
Standout Feature

Customer self-scheduling portal with real-time availability and instant confirmations

CleanGuru is a cloud-based software tailored for cleaning service businesses, offering tools for online booking, scheduling, dispatching, invoicing, and payment processing. It includes a mobile app for cleaners to manage jobs on the go, a customer portal for self-scheduling, and integrations with QuickBooks and Stripe. The platform helps streamline operations from lead management to recurring service billing.

Pros

  • Intuitive scheduling and dispatching tools
  • Robust mobile app for field staff
  • Seamless QuickBooks and payment integrations

Cons

  • Higher pricing tiers for advanced features
  • Limited advanced reporting and analytics
  • Occasional reports of slow customer support response

Best For

Small to medium cleaning businesses needing reliable scheduling and online booking without complex setup.

Pricing

Starts at $29/month for Solo plan, $59/month for Small Team, $99/month for Growing Team, with Enterprise custom pricing.

Visit CleanGurucleanguru.com
5
Swept logo

Swept

specialized

Operations platform for cleaning businesses automating scheduling, billing, and franchise management.

Overall Rating8.4/10
Features
8.6/10
Ease of Use
9.1/10
Value
8.0/10
Standout Feature

Self-service client portal enabling 24/7 online booking, rescheduling, and payments with real-time availability syncing.

Swept is a specialized software platform for cleaning service businesses, offering tools for online booking, automated scheduling, invoicing, and team dispatching. It features a client self-service portal for easy appointment management and recurring bookings, along with mobile apps for staff to access jobs and communicate in real-time. Designed for house cleaners and commercial cleaning companies, it streamlines operations to reduce admin time and improve customer satisfaction.

Pros

  • Intuitive client booking portal for self-scheduling
  • Strong mobile app for field staff
  • Automated invoicing and payment processing

Cons

  • Limited advanced reporting and analytics
  • Fewer integrations with third-party tools
  • Pricing scales quickly for larger teams

Best For

Small to mid-sized residential cleaning businesses seeking simple, client-focused scheduling without complex enterprise features.

Pricing

Starts at $59/month for solo cleaners (billed annually), Pro plan at $99/month for teams up to 5 cleaners, and Enterprise at $199+/month.

Visit Swepthelloswept.com
6
BookingKoala logo

BookingKoala

specialized

Online booking and scheduling software designed for cleaning services with automated reminders and payments.

Overall Rating8.4/10
Features
8.2/10
Ease of Use
8.7/10
Value
9.0/10
Standout Feature

White-label mobile app that allows customers to book and manage services under your brand

BookingKoala is an all-in-one booking and management platform tailored for cleaning services and home service businesses, enabling 24/7 online scheduling, automated payments, and customer communications. It features customizable service menus with packages and add-ons, drag-and-drop scheduling, and built-in CRM for managing leads and jobs. The software supports multi-location operations and includes marketing tools like email/SMS campaigns to boost bookings.

Pros

  • Affordable pricing with robust all-in-one features for small businesses
  • Intuitive drag-and-drop scheduler and mobile-friendly interface
  • Customizable service packs and white-label customer app for branding

Cons

  • Limited third-party integrations compared to enterprise competitors
  • Reporting and analytics could be more advanced
  • Customer support response times can vary

Best For

Small to medium-sized cleaning companies seeking an cost-effective, user-friendly solution for online bookings and basic operations without complex needs.

Pricing

Starts at $27/month (Starter plan) up to $197/month (Enterprise), billed annually with a 30-day free trial.

Visit BookingKoalabookingkoala.com
7
ServiceTitan logo

ServiceTitan

enterprise

Enterprise-grade platform for cleaning and home services with advanced CRM, dispatching, and financial tools.

Overall Rating7.6/10
Features
8.2/10
Ease of Use
7.0/10
Value
6.5/10
Standout Feature

Smart Dispatch Board that optimizes routes, assigns jobs, and maximizes technician utilization in real-time

ServiceTitan is a comprehensive field service management (FSM) platform primarily designed for home service trades like HVAC and plumbing, but adaptable for cleaning services through its scheduling, dispatching, and invoicing tools. It enables cleaning businesses to manage jobs, track technician performance, handle customer communications, and generate reports in real-time via a mobile app. While not specialized for cleaning-specific needs like supply tracking or recurring maid schedules, it offers scalable operations for growing service providers.

Pros

  • All-in-one platform covering scheduling, dispatching, CRM, and invoicing
  • Robust mobile app for real-time job updates and technician empowerment
  • Advanced analytics and reporting for business insights

Cons

  • Expensive pricing not ideal for small cleaning operations
  • Steep learning curve due to extensive features
  • Less tailored for cleaning-specific workflows like inventory for supplies

Best For

Mid-to-large cleaning service companies needing scalable FSM with strong dispatching and analytics.

Pricing

Custom quote-based pricing; typically $200+ per user/month with minimums, plus setup fees.

Visit ServiceTitanservicetitan.com
8
Kickserv logo

Kickserv

specialized

Field service software for cleaning operations including job management, time tracking, and reporting.

Overall Rating8.1/10
Features
8.3/10
Ease of Use
8.5/10
Value
7.8/10
Standout Feature

Visual drag-and-drop dispatch board with real-time GPS tracking for optimized technician routing

Kickserv is a cloud-based field service management platform tailored for small to medium-sized service businesses, including cleaning services, offering scheduling, dispatching, invoicing, and customer management tools. It features a drag-and-drop calendar for job assignment, a mobile app for technicians to access jobs and update statuses in real-time, and supports recurring appointments ideal for regular cleaning schedules. The software integrates with QuickBooks and other accounting tools for seamless billing and includes GPS tracking for route optimization.

Pros

  • Intuitive drag-and-drop scheduling and dispatch board
  • Robust mobile app for field technicians
  • Excellent support for recurring jobs and customer portals
  • Strong integrations with QuickBooks and Stripe

Cons

  • Reporting and analytics lack depth compared to top competitors
  • No built-in inventory management for supplies
  • Customer support primarily email-based with no live chat
  • Pricing can become expensive with multiple users

Best For

Small to mid-sized cleaning service providers focused on efficient scheduling of recurring residential and commercial jobs without needing advanced CRM features.

Pricing

Starts at $59/user/month (billed annually) for Pro plan; Premier at $89/user/month (min 3 users); custom Enterprise pricing available.

Visit Kickservkickserv.com
9
FieldPulse logo

FieldPulse

specialized

Mobile CRM and scheduling tool for cleaning services supporting jobs, estimates, and invoicing on the go.

Overall Rating8.1/10
Features
8.3/10
Ease of Use
8.7/10
Value
7.5/10
Standout Feature

Real-time GPS tracking with automated dispatching and route optimization for efficient field operations

FieldPulse is an all-in-one field service management platform tailored for service businesses like cleaning companies, offering tools for job scheduling, technician dispatching, invoicing, and customer communication. It features a mobile app for on-the-go job updates, GPS tracking, recurring job management, and QuickBooks integration to streamline billing and accounting. Ideal for cleaning services, it supports checklists, time tracking, and customer portals for service requests and payments.

Pros

  • Intuitive drag-and-drop scheduling and mobile app for technicians
  • Seamless QuickBooks integration and one-click invoicing
  • Real-time GPS tracking and customer self-scheduling portal

Cons

  • Pricing scales quickly with users and advanced features
  • Limited built-in cleaning-specific templates or checklists
  • Setup and onboarding can take time for complex operations

Best For

Small to mid-sized cleaning companies with mobile crews needing robust scheduling and billing automation.

Pricing

Starts at $65/user/month (Starter, billed annually), up to $149/user/month (Enterprise), with setup fees and add-ons.

Visit FieldPulsefieldpulse.com
10
Workiz logo

Workiz

specialized

Cloud-based management system for service businesses like cleaning with scheduling, invoicing, and call tracking.

Overall Rating7.9/10
Features
8.2/10
Ease of Use
7.6/10
Value
7.4/10
Standout Feature

Integrated call center with intelligent call routing, SMS automation, and IVR for handling customer inquiries and bookings

Workiz is an all-in-one field service management software tailored for service businesses like cleaning companies, offering scheduling, dispatching, invoicing, and CRM tools. It enables real-time job tracking via GPS, mobile app access for technicians to update job status and collect payments, and seamless integrations with accounting software like QuickBooks. While versatile for various field services, it supports cleaning operations through recurring job scheduling and team management.

Pros

  • Robust dispatching and real-time GPS tracking for efficient team management
  • Strong mobile app for on-the-go job updates and payments
  • Excellent integrations with QuickBooks and payment processors

Cons

  • Pricing can be high for small cleaning businesses
  • Steep learning curve for new users
  • Lacks deep cleaning-specific features like supply inventory tracking

Best For

Medium-sized cleaning companies with multiple field teams needing advanced dispatching and customer communication tools.

Pricing

Starts at $65/user/month (billed annually) for basic plans, up to $165+/user/month for premium tiers with advanced features; custom enterprise pricing available.

Visit Workizworkiz.com

Conclusion

The reviewed software offers tailored solutions for cleaning businesses, with ZenMaid leading as the top choice due to its comprehensive coverage of scheduling, invoicing, and team management. Jobber and Housecall Pro stand out as strong alternatives, each excelling in areas like GPS tracking and mobile accessibility, catering to different operational needs. Ultimately, ZenMaid proves to be the most well-rounded option for most cleaning services.

ZenMaid logo
Our Top Pick
ZenMaid

Explore ZenMaid today to experience a streamlined workflow that simplifies scheduling, invoicing, and client management—empowering your business to operate more efficiently and grow with ease.